So I FINALLY got my first fill on 10/21. It took forever because I switched aftercare docs cuz I moved, and went to see my sister for 2 weeks.

I was a bit upset at my weigh in cuz I was 5lbs up, but I had been at my sisters and eating what they cooked. But then my nutritionist asked if I had been working out. Well I had been doing a LOT of walking while on vacation. She said she could tell because my muscle was way up, and fat down. I told her I seemed to drop a size in clothes and she explained that was why. Even thou the scale said I weighed more, it was because of the muscle gain somewhat. She said it was typical that some ppl will gain a bit before a fill after healing up too. So that made me feel MUCH BETTER! Another NSV!

Last night I bought some size 24 pants from Avenue. I was estatic when I put them on and they fit even a bit loose. I had gotten up to 26 and even had a couple 28's! WOOHOO>>>it's working, it's working! :biggrin:

Well I got my fill and like everyone says, it doesn't hurt. I was nervous cuz I'm not the best with needles, and my new doc does adjustments w/ fluroscopy. It was no biggie at all, they put in too much at first, and by drinking the barrium we could see it wasn't draining past the band at all. So the took out .5cc and it was perfect! I only got 1.5cc, but it's working. It's been about 2 weeks and I'm down 10lbs. I'm not eating super clean either. Pretty Protein heavy, but still having some carbs here and there. But I'm eating WAY cleaner than I used to. My mom and I were talking about it, and figured I'm not getting 300-1000 calories a day just from sodas. I used to drink A LOT of coke, so I'm sure that's helping quite a bit.

Anyway...things are going great! I'm eating sooooo much less than I was. The other night I had 6-8 small shrimp and some salad was was stuffed! That still just amazes me!

Hope everyone else is making good progress too! I'm down a total of 26lbs. I feel like I'm making good progress, not sure how I'm doing compared to others. But I have hypothyroid and PCOS which both work against me, so just losing something is AWESOME to me! I can't remember the last time I was able to drop weight and keep it off. :biggrin:
